1. Rebuild Cost Assessment
Underinsurance is a risk that many businesses unknowingly take, often assuming their current insurance covers the full rebuilding cost – but this can lead to shortfalls when disaster strikes.
Rebuild Cost Assessment helps prevent this by offering precise valuations of your building’s rebuild costs, with expert-led assessments to ensure your property is properly covered and prevent costly gaps in your policy. With a straightforward online process and experienced surveyors, they provide a crucial service for businesses looking to secure accurate insurance coverage.
Whether you’re a commercial landlord, office owner, or retail business, Rebuild Cost Assessment’s evaluations give you peace of mind that your insurance reflects real-world rebuilding costs.

6. NFU Mutual
For businesses seeking a personal touch in their insurance provider, NFU Mutual is unlike large-scale insurers, emphasizing building strong relationships with clients and providing tailored insurance solutions.
Their buildings insurance covers full rebuild costs, including professional fees and accidental damage. They also offer business interruption coverage, ensuring financial support if your premises become unusable.
With local branches and dedicated agents, NFU Mutual delivers a hands-on service that’s particularly appealing to small businesses, farms, and rural enterprises. Their reputation for excellent customer service and fair claims handling makes them a trusted choice.
